The world gone awry: natural disasters and risk

The beach at Khao Lak, Thailand, on December 26, 2004, with the first tsunami wave heading toward shore swissinfo.ch

Today, local disasters – tornadoes, tsunamis, earthquakes, volcanic eruptions – are global as well. Internationally, among scientists and governments, there is a move toward multidisciplinary cooperation in the management of risk.
